Specification:
You need to implement a position based routing protocol for vehicle ad hoc network in ns2 like GPSR routing protocol.
Details:
I want to implement a position based routing protocol for vehicle ad hoc network like GPSR, gpsr is using the greedy forwarding strategy which based on forward the packet to node that is closer to destination, it take under its consideration the position of each neighbour node and their direction
what i want to do is to add another parameter which take two values 0 or 1 and according to that the forwarder node will select the next hop node by select the nodes that have position closer to destination than itself and have the same direction and have the value 0 for the proposed parameter .
Assumptions:
•We assume that the forwarding node already knows the location of destination node
•Each node in the network have information about its surrounding node (neighbours nodes), such as position, speed, direction and other information as needed, by broadcasting a periodic beacon massage
Note: We can call the proposed protocol enhanced GPSR (EGPSR)
Through using the multi hope technique the node that hold the packet intend to forward it to an appropriate next hop node,
In GPSR the forwarding node select the node that have closest position to packet‘s destination than itself According to greedy forwarding strategy without take into account the direction and other parameters
In my protocol (EGPSR) the node that encounters the packet will select the next hop node according to the following condition:
•Next hop Position (closest to destination than itself ): it represent a filed in the packet header
•Have direction toward the destination :it represent a filed in the packet header
•have a K=0 , if we know that K is a third parameter have two values (0 or 1) in case there is no node that have a K=0, then the node with highest speed will be selected
The most important thing is to add the K parameter in the packet header and take it into account when the node wants to select the next hop node from its neighbour’s nodes.
